How much do manager python j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 7, 2026, the average hourly pay for manager python in Chicago, IL is $60.39,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$49.76 and $68.61 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Manager Python vs Python Developer?

AspectManager PythonPython Developer
Primary RoleOversees Python projects, manages teams, and aligns development with business goalsWrites, tests, and maintains Python code for applications and systems
Required SkillsLeadership, project management, Python knowledge, communication skillsStrong Python programming, problem-solving, technical expertise
Work EnvironmentTeam management, strategic planning, collaboration with stakeholdersHands-on coding, debugging, software development
CertificationsProject Management Professional (PMP), Python certifications beneficialPython certifications (e.g., PCAP, PCPP), coding bootcamps

In summary, a Manager Python focuses on leading Python development teams and managing projects, while a Python Developer primarily concentrates on coding and technical tasks. Both roles require Python skills, but their responsibilities and skill sets differ significantly.

Job description

DRW is a diversified trading firm with over 3 decades of experience bringing sophisticated technology and exceptional people together to operate in markets around the world. We value autonomy and the ability to quickly pivot to capture opportunities, so we operate using our own capital and trading at our own risk.
Headquartered in Chicago with offices throughout the U.S., Canada, Europe, and Asia, we trade a variety of asset classes including Fixed Income, ETFs, Equities, FX, Commodities and Energy across all major global markets. We have also leveraged our expertise and technology to expand into three non-traditional strategies: real estate, venture capital and cryptoassets.
We operate with respect, curiosity and open minds. The people who thrive here share our belief that it's not just what we do that matters-it's how we do it. DRW is a place of high expectations, integrity, innovation and a willingness to challenge consensus.
About the Team
DRW's Prediction Markets Desk is a new trading desk building trading across prediction market venues. The desk is looking for engineers who want to own critical systems in a fast-moving, high-autonomy environment. We embed deeply with quantitative researchers and traders to turn pricing models, risk frameworks, and trade lifecycle requirements into scalable, reliable production systems.
About the Role
Software Engineers on the Prediction Markets Desk will build systems that take the desk from idea to production trading, including real-time pricing input pipelines, middle office, cross-venue reconciliation, and risk.
  • During a build phase, you will be directly embedded with the desk lead and quantitative researchers, navigating ambiguity in requirements, making trade-offs, and delivering systems that the desk depends on to know what it owns, what it paid, and whether its books are clean.
  • As the desk matures, you will harden and extend these systems - extracting reusable patterns, improving reliability, and scaling infrastructure to support new venues and market categories.

In this role you will:
  • Grow research tooling and infrastructure to support the business
  • Implement trading signals and strategies
  • Create infrastructure that allows the desk to efficiently capture market opportunity
  • Take full ownership of the products you create, from prototype to stable production
  • Work with both greenfield and legacy systems, primarily in Python
  • Provide on-call support as needed

Qualifications:
  • A minimum of 2+ years' experience in Python, with the ability to work comfortably across multiple programming languages
  • A track record of working directly with end customers, scoping and delivering production systems in fast-moving and ambiguous environments
  • Experience building trade capture, position management, middle-office, or reconciliation systems
  • Familiarity with real-time data processing and multi-venue environments
  • Familiarity interacting with on-chain data
  • Understanding of trading operations (order lifecycle, break resolution, audit trails, PnL calculation)
  • Ability to dive deep into complex problems, develop intuitive understandings, spot risks early, and minimize complexity
  • Exceptional interpersonal skills - you communicate clearly with traders, researchers, and other engineers, fostering a collaborative, supportive working environment
  • Experience in the financial markets, crypto, or prediction markets is a plus
  • Experience with linux-based, concurrent, high-throughput software systems
  • Have a Bachelors or advanced degree in Computer Science, Mathematics, Statistics, Physics, Engineering, or equivalent work experience

The annual base salary range for this position is $150,000 to $225,000 depending on the candidate's experience, qualifications, and relevant skill set. The position is also eligible for an annual discretionary bonus. In addition, DRW offers a comprehensive suite of employee benefits including group medical, pharmacy, dental and vision insurance, 401k (with discretionary employer match), short and long-term disability, life and AD&D insurance, health savings accounts, and flexible spending accounts.
